<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	>

<channel>
	<title>Проектант &#187; Фотогалерея для drupal</title>
	<atom:link href="https://k-det.dp.ua/tag/%D1%84%D0%BE%D1%82%D0%BE%D0%B3%D0%B0%D0%BB%D0%B5%D1%80%D0%B5%D1%8F-%D0%B4%D0%BB%D1%8F-drupal/feed/" rel="self" type="application/rss+xml" />
	<link>https://k-det.dp.ua</link>
	<description>Стань еще умнее!</description>
	<lastBuildDate>Tue, 07 May 2024 07:13:23 +0000</lastBuildDate>
	<language>ru-RU</language>
		<sy:updatePeriod>hourly</sy:updatePeriod>
		<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.org/?v=4.0</generator>
	<item>
		<title>Фотогалереи на Drupal</title>
		<link>https://k-det.dp.ua/fotogalerei-na-drupal/</link>
		<comments>https://k-det.dp.ua/fotogalerei-na-drupal/#comments</comments>
		<pubDate>Tue, 01 Mar 2011 06:21:47 +0000</pubDate>
		<dc:creator><![CDATA[kdet_blog]]></dc:creator>
				<category><![CDATA[Drupal статьи]]></category>
		<category><![CDATA[Фотогалерея для drupal]]></category>

		<guid isPermaLink="false">http://k-det.dp.ua/?p=552</guid>
		<description><![CDATA[Существует множество способов показать изображения посетителю сайта на Drupal. Начиная от простоко копирования изображений на хостинг через FTP с последующей встввкой ссылок на них в HTML коде и заканчивая готовыми платными решениями сторонних разработчиков. Оптимальным вариантом представляется использование бесплатных модулей &#8230; <a href="https://k-det.dp.ua/fotogalerei-na-drupal/">Читать далее <span class="meta-nav">&#8594;</span></a>]]></description>
				<content:encoded><![CDATA[<div>
<p>Существует множество способов показать изображения посетителю сайта на Drupal. Начиная от простоко копирования изображений на хостинг через FTP с последующей встввкой ссылок на них в HTML коде и заканчивая готовыми платными решениями сторонних разработчиков. Оптимальным вариантом представляется использование бесплатных модулей для Drupal. О некоторых из них и пойдет здесь речь.</p>
<h3>Модуль Image</h3>
<p>Классика жанра. Модуль Image включает в себя модули: <strong>Image Attach</strong>, <strong>Image Gallery</strong>, <strong>Image Import</strong>, <strong>ImageMagick Advanced Options</strong><br />
Для корректного подключения последнего нужно руками скопировать файл<br />
<samp>sites/all/modules/image/image.imagemagick.inc</samp></p>
<p>в каталог<br />
<samp>includes</samp></p>
<p>а затем выбрать <strong>ImageMagick Advanced Options</strong> на странице<br />
<samp>/admin/settings/image-toolkit</samp></p>
<p>.<br />
Включив модуль Image, мы получим дополнительный тип материала &#8220;Изображение&#8221;, который отличается от встроенных Страница (Page) или Заметка (Store) наличием дополнительного поля &#8220;Изображение&#8221;. Указанный в нем графический файл отображается над содержимым материала (ноды).</p>
<p>Модуль <strong>Image Gallery</strong> создает словарь таксономии &#8220;Image Galleries&#8221;, привязанный по умолчанию к типу материала &#8220;Изображение&#8221;. Но не смотря на использование встроенного в Друпал механизма таксономии, для управления галлереями в админке создается отдельная страница:<br />
<samp>/admin/content/image</samp></p>
<p>. И так, галереи соответствуют терминам таксономии, которые в Друпале в общем случае могут иметь иерархическую структуру. Ссылка на список галерей на вашем сайте будет иметь вид<br />
<samp>http://имя_сайта/image</samp></p>
<p>. Описанием для каждой галереи будет служить описание соответствующего термина словаря (таксономии). Миниатюра первого изображения галереи будет являться обложкой альбома. Выбрав щелчком мыши галерею из списка, попадаем на страницу с миниатюрами изображений. Количество миниатюр на одной странице галереи настраивается на<br />
<samp>/admin/settings/image/image_gallery</samp></p>
<p>. Размеры так же можно указать на свое усмотрение. Если в галерее изображений больше, чем задано для одной страницы, то под миниатюрами автоматически формируется блок кнопок для перелистывания страниц галереи. Для каждого изображения можно указать заголовок и описание в его ноде. Если не задействован <strong>Lightbox2</strong> или другой подобный обработчик, то щелчок по миниатюре в галерее приводит к переходу на страницу данного изображения, т.е. на его ноду. Если же Lightbox2 установлен и на странице<br />
<samp>/admin/settings/lightbox2/automatic</samp></p>
<p>установлен параметр &#8220;Automatic handler for image nodes:&#8221; в значение &#8220;Lightbox&#8221;, &#8220;Lightbox grouped&#8221; или &#8220;Slideshow&#8221;, то наша галерея приобретает вполне презентабельный вид и может листаться навигационными кнопками или быть запущенной в режиме слайдшоу.</p>
<p>Для выгрузки сразу большого количества изображений нужно подключить модуль <strong>Image Import</strong> и на странице<br />
<samp>/admin/settings/image/image_import</samp></p>
<p>задать каталог на сервере, из которого модуль <strong>Image </strong>будет импортировать изображения в ноды и галереи. Путь можно задать либо от корня каталога, где установлен друпал, записав без предварительного слэша, например,<br />
<samp>&#8220;tmp/image&#8221;</samp></p>
<p>, либо от корня сервера (включая в путь свой домашний каталог), например,<br />
<samp>&#8220;/home/urername/tmp/image&#8221;</samp></p>
<p>с предварительным слэшем. Система проверит наличие указанного каталога и сообщит о возможности его использования. Теперь можно выгрузить в этот каталог файлы с помощью FTP клиента. После этого на странице<br />
<samp>/admin/content/image_import</samp></p>
<p>их можно будет скопировать или перенести в выбранную галерею.</p>
<h3>Модуль Fast Gallery</h3>
<p>Соответствуя своему названию, позволяет создать вполне презентабельную (благодаря Lightbox) галерею достаточно <em>быстро</em>. Однако, предлагаемый модулем функционал несколько аскетичен. После установки в админке Друпала не добавляется нового типа материала, а по адресу<br />
<samp>/admin/settings/fast_gallery</samp></p>
<p>появляется страничка &#8220;Fast Gallery&#8221;, состоящая из двух разделов: &#8220;Default &#8211; Storage engine&#8221;, &#8220;General configuration&#8221;. В первом задается порядок сортировки и количество изображений на каждой странице галерей. Если в галерее изображений больше, чем здесь задано, то автоматически формируется блок кнопок для навигации по страницам галереи.<br />
В разделе &#8220;General configuration&#8221; добавляются галереи просто указанием трех параметров: расположение файлов на сервере, адрес для ссылок из браузера, название (заголовок) галереи. Здесь же еще несколько параметров отображения галереи и кнопки пересканирования каталогов и очистки кэша. На этой странице нужно не забыть изменить параметр &#8220;How would you like to present your gallery?&#8221; на &#8220;Lightbox&#8221; или &#8220;Lightshow&#8221;.</p>
<p><span style="text-decoration: underline;">Недостатки</span>:<br />
Все параметры галерей: кол-во изображений на странице, порядок сортировки, способ показа (Lightbox, Lightshow) задаются для ВСЕХ галерей едиными.<br />
Нет возможности задать размер миниатюр, сделать подписи к изображениям и к самой галерее. Если в самих изображениях через IPTC задать заголовок изображения для показа его в галерее, то возможны проблемы с кодировкой при отображении кириллицы.</p>
<h3>Модуль Gallerix</h3>
<p>Отличный модуль.Реализует два режима просмотра:<br />
&#8211; все изображения галереи в виде миниатюр занимают отведенное для ноды пространство;<br />
&#8211; одно выбранное изображение показано крупно в заданных размерах, а под ним лента из нескольких миниатюр, размеры и количество которых так же настраивается.</p>
<p>Если нужно, чтобы <strong>сопроводительный текст</strong> галлереи (Album Description) отображался не снизу под изображениями, а сверху (до них), то в файле gallerix.module в строке 985 меняем &#8220;-1&#8243; на положительное число, скажем, на &#8220;10&#8221;</p>
<p>(+) в каждой галерее можно независимо опредлеять порядок сортировки (по дате, по имени, случайный) или определять порядок следования изображений вручную</p>
<p>(-) Вид просмотра по умолчанию (Grid, Single) для всех галерей общий.<br />
Совсем нет разбивки на страницы. Если изображений много, то надо вручную делить их на разные галереи</p>
</div>
<script type="text/javascript">(function (w, doc) {
    if (!w.__utlWdgt) {
        w.__utlWdgt = true;
        var d = doc, s = d.createElement('script'), g = 'getElementsByTagName';
        s.type = 'text/javascript';
        s.charset = 'UTF-8';
        s.async = true;
        s.src = ('https:' == w.location.protocol ? 'https' : 'http') + '://w.uptolike.com/widgets/v1/uptolike.js';
        var h = d[g]('body')[0];
        h.appendChild(s);
    }
})(window, document);
</script>
<div style="text-align:left;" data-lang="ru" data-url="https://k-det.dp.ua/fotogalerei-na-drupal/" data-url data-background-alpha="0.0" data-orientation="horizontal" data-text-color="000000" data-share-shape="round-rectangle" data-buttons-color="ff9300" data-sn-ids="fb.tw.ok.vk.gp.mr." data-counter-background-color="ffffff" data-share-counter-size="11" data-share-size="30" data-background-color="ededed" data-share-counter-type="common" data-pid="cmskdetdpua" data-counter-background-alpha="1.0" data-share-style="1" data-mode="share" data-following-enable="false" data-like-text-enable="false" data-selection-enable="true" data-icon-color="ffffff" class="uptolike-buttons">
</div>]]></content:encoded>
			<wfw:commentRss>https://k-det.dp.ua/fotogalerei-na-drupal/feed/</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
	</channel>
</rss>
